Abstract Engineering Education Accreditation is of great significance in the professional reform of colleges and universities. Experimental teaching is a core link that supports Engineering Education Accreditation in cultivating students' ability to solve complex engineering problems, which can enhance the students' comprehensive competence and practical skills. Guided by the concept of Engineering Education Accreditation, this paper analyzes the shortcomings of the traditional experimental teaching model for the major of Electronic Information Engineering in our university. The experimental reform is explored from four dimensions: diversified course design, intelligent-teaching construction, personalized program formulation and comprehensive assessment improvement, which aims to cultivate students' innovative and practical abilities, explore the optimal teaching methods for talent training and enhance teaching quality and student satisfaction.
